
CORONA, CA – September 1, 2020 – (Motor Sports NewsWire) – New accessories for the 2008-2020 Yamaha TT-R110 are now in stock and ready for some mini moto riding. A new top clamp and bar mount, engine plug kit and a throttle tube are available and all are machined from aircraft-grade aluminum then anodized and polished for a true works look mini bike riders will appreciate. TT-R110 Top Clamp and Bar Mount
Designed to suit the taller rider, the Pro Circuit top clamp and bar mount helps create more legroom by raising the handlebars. It’s the perfect solution to prevent knees from smacking the bars, and it will also make your TT-R110’s front end longer. The clamp has full adjustability with different bar mount configurations, so you are able to personalize fitment as well. The clamp and bar mount are CNC-machined out of aluminum and then anodized blue and black for a factory look.
TT-R110 Throttle Tube
Pro Circuit throttle tubes are CNC-machined out of aluminum, and are Teflon coated on the inside to reduce friction which gives you a smoother twist of the throttle.
TT-R110 Engine Plug Kit
Engine plug kits are machined from aircraft-grade aluminum, anodized blue and hand polished for a true works look.
